Why does my car smell like gas while idling?

Why does my car smell like gas while idling?

If there’s too much fuel and not enough air, the mixture is rich. When a rich mixture is injected, some of the gasoline may not be burned by combustion. If this happens, your exhaust will probably look black or dark grey, and you’ll likely smell gas when the engine is at idle or in traffic.

Why does my car smell like petrol but no leak?

Fuel evaporates very quickly, so a small leak can have a big smell but no visible signs of a leak. If you notice your engine does not seem to run as smoothly or your check engine light comes on with your fuel smell, then the smell is likely from the engine running poorly.

Why does the inside of my car smell like petrol?

Injector leaks are one of the most common causes of a petrol smell. Upon inspecting the injector, if there is fuel stored around the injector it is the issue causing the gasoline smell. There also may be increased moisture around the injector which is another pointer of the gas smell.

Can a bad fuel pump cause gas smell?

Fuel Pump. A leak in the fuel pump assembly could cause fuel vapors from the gas tank to escape. On some vehicles, the fuel pump is near the cabin. This means even a very small vapor leak will be detectable by your nose when you get in the car.

Why does my garage smell like gasoline?

Gasoline odors can be caused by a leak somewhere in the fuel system, meaning gasoline can be dripping out. There’s a vent for your fuel tank that may also leak. The fuel filler neck can wear out and fail. One thing you should look for is to see if there are any puddles of gasoline on the floor of your garage.

Can a car smell petrol?

A petrol smell from the front end of the car is often caused by a fuel injector leak. To remedy this, a mechanic may need to replace just the seals or the entire set of fuel injectors. Petrol caps are supposed to seal the fumes from the tank, but if the cap is loose, you may have a petrol smell in the car.

Why does the outside of my car smell like gas?

Irregular Fuel Pressure A bad fuel pressure regulator can cause your car to burn too rich or too thin a fuel mixture. Anyone outside of the car will notice the smell of gas vapors while it runs. If exhaust enters your ventilation system through a leak, the interior may also begin to smell like gas fumes.

Does diesel smell like petrol?

A safer way to tell is to smell what you know is gasoline or diesel fuel, at the same time, compared they smell quite different. Another way is feel. Gasoline has the consistency of water and will dry almost to powder on your hands, while diesel is lighty oily and will stay wet on your hands much longer.

How do you stop a car from smelling like gas?

Check each spark plug one by one until you have tightened each one to the proper torque. These are the crush/sealing washers that stop fumes from leaking out of the combustion chamber. If a spark plug is loose, you could get a gas smell inside the car.

How can you tell if your car has a fuel leak?

Have the engine running and take a look, if you have a fuel leak, you will definitely smell it, and it will be wet with fuel around the injector that has the problem. I would have to say that a fuel tank leak is probably the most common fuel leak of all.

Why is there a gas smell coming out of my injectors?

Wear and tear can cause these seals to deteriorate, producing a leak. The injectors can also leak if they are old and worn. If this is the cause, you’ll notice a very obvious gas smell. Your mechanic should check both the injectors and the seals.
